The Hungarian economy has been increased in May
According to the common indicator of Világgazdaság and Ecostat – called the speed-up guide (GYIA) – after the decline of April, the economy increased by 0.33 percent in May.
It is difficult to interpret it as a trend because the positive and the negative range is continuously changing from month to month. However, it is clear that the fall of the economy has been stopped. In an annual comparison there is still a huge decline in the GDP based statistics of Economy Research Institute (GKI). The fall in external demand has been shown to stop, but the internal market is clearly goes downward. Analysts expect a turnaround for the second half of the year, but there is an emergency scenario that one can expect for long stagnation – reports Világgazdaság Online.
